Allianz Asset Management GmbH increased its holdings in Cloudflare, Inc. (NYSE:NET - Free Report) by 5.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 25,700 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 1,288 shares during the quarter. Allianz Asset Management GmbH's holdings in Cloudflare were worth $2,897,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Cloudflare (NYSE:NET -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The company reported $0.21 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.18 by $0.03. Cloudflare had a negative return on equity of 6.31% and a negative net margin of 4.62%. The company had revenue of $512.32 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$501.58 million.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.20 earnings per share. The firm's revenue was up 27.8%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ities analysts predict that Cloudflare, Inc. will post -0.11 EPS for the current year.

Cloudflare Company Profile

(Free Report)

Cloudflare, Inc operates as a cloud services provider that delivers a range of services to businesses worldwide. The company provides an integrated cloud-based security solution to secure a range of combination of platforms, including public cloud, private cloud, on-premise, software-as-a-service applications, and IoT devices; and website and application security products comprising web application firewall, bot management, distributed denial of service, API gateways, SSL/TLS encryption, script management, security center, and rate limiting products.
